Output 29553901cd0d627de02333ff43aa138609158d326c5fe49d4a910f17868977cf:5

value
755679819
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 272357306b6b8c88efc69306d538e09805e9a51d66656177b06620a8236dcf46
address
tb1pyu34wvrtdwxg3m7xjvrd2w8qnqz7nfgavejkzaasvcs2sgmdearqhpvnfw
transaction
29553901cd0d627de02333ff43aa138609158d326c5fe49d4a910f17868977cf
confirmations
26520
spent
true